WebApr 13, 2024 · Preheat the oven to 450 degrees F. Season salmon with salt and pepper. Place salmon, skin side down, on a non-stick baking sheet or in a non-stick pan with an oven-proof handle. Bake until salmon is cooked through, about 12 to 15 minutes. WebFeb 14, 2024 · For best results, start with a hot oven here, from 425°F to 450°F. It has five primary cooking modes: Air Fry, Bake, Broil (Low), Broil (High), … WebPreheat oven to 450°F. Line a 9″x13″ baking sheet with foil. Rub olive oil on foil. Place the salmon on the oiled foil, skin side up. Season skin with half of the salt and half the black pepper. Flip the salmon over. Sprinkle top with remaining salt and pepper.
